Transaction 1dd44c3ad3b2506eadb11d350e39d507e30f011671827fd0d9d552408f850e33
1 Input
1 Output
-
1dd44c3ad3b2506eadb11d350e39d507e30f011671827fd0d9d552408f850e33:0
- value
- 2251463
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d69ac0bb69bb47d619de8e4ef49a9355112ff10c OP_EQUAL
- address
- 3MFjv1gqM3emW6VTwUft4xLMJxz8vyPojK